Ban from driving has been awarded to the Stone Roses singer Ian Brown.
In October 2010, the 'Waterfall' singer was caught speeding at 93 miles per hour (mph) while in a 40mph roadwork zone near Stafford while on his way to his home in Cheshire, in North West England.
As the singer had exceeded the prescribed limit, the 48-year-old musician who was driving his £40,000 Lexus car received a ban for three months by a judge.
Besides, the singer was also ordered to pay £1,015 costs and given a £900 fine.
